DomainTools Iris and Silent Push Platform compete in the threat intelligence space. Silent Push offers a more comprehensive feature set, which may justify its higher price point.
Features: DomainTools Iris focuses on domain profiling, enriched telemetry data, and reverse WHOIS lookup. Silent Push Platform provides dynamic threat data, customizable alerts, and enhanced integration options.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: DomainTools Iris offers a straightforward SaaS solution with reliable customer support. Silent Push offers cloud and on-premise solutions, accommodating diverse IT environments, with tailored customer service.
Pricing and ROI: DomainTools Iris has a moderate setup cost with predictable ROI. Silent Push, with adaptable solutions, entails a higher initial investment but aims for superior ROI through extensive threat intelligence tools.
Iris is a proprietary threat intelligence and investigation platform that combines enterprise-grade domain and DNS-based intelligence with an intuitive web interface, helping security teams quickly and efficiently investigate potential cybercrime and cyberespionage.
Silent Push Platform delivers advanced threat intelligence and cybersecurity solutions to protect digital assets. It identifies and mitigates threats in real-time, ensuring safe and secure operations for businesses with minimal disruptions.
Silent Push Platform provides a comprehensive suite of features designed to enhance security operations. It efficiently aggregates threat data, offers real-time alerts, and integrates seamless with existing infrastructures. The platform's adaptability and proactive threat detection capabilities are crucial for companies aiming to stay ahead of security threats. Users benefit from its intuitive functionality, although some reviews suggest room for improving analytics depth and customizable reporting.
